r3805 - jhalfs/trunk

pierre at higgs.linuxfromscratch.org pierre at higgs.linuxfromscratch.org
Tue Sep 23 13:18:44 PDT 2014


Author: pierre
Date: Tue Sep 23 13:18:44 2014
New Revision: 3805

Log:
small corrections to install-blfs-tools.sh

Modified:
   jhalfs/trunk/install-blfs-tools.sh

Modified: jhalfs/trunk/install-blfs-tools.sh
==============================================================================
--- jhalfs/trunk/install-blfs-tools.sh	Tue Sep 16 00:55:23 2014	(r3804)
+++ jhalfs/trunk/install-blfs-tools.sh	Tue Sep 23 13:18:44 2014	(r3805)
@@ -14,10 +14,10 @@
 Examples:
 1 - If you plan to use the tools to build BLFS on top of LFS, but you did not
 use jhalfs, or forgot to include the jhalfs-blfs tools:
-(as root) mkdir -p /var/lib/jhalfs/BLFS && chown -R user /var/lib/jhalfs
-(as user) ./install-blfs-tools
+(as root) mkdir -p /var/lib/jhalfs/BLFS && chown -R <user> /var/lib/jhalfs
+(as user) ./install-blfs-tools.sh
 2 - To install with only user privileges:
-TRACKING_DIR=/home/user/blfs_root/trackdir ./install-blfs-tools
+TRACKING_DIR=$HOME/blfs_root/trackdir ./install-blfs-tools.sh
 inline_doc
 
 
@@ -97,6 +97,8 @@
 rm -rf ${BUILDDIR}${BLFS_ROOT}/xsl/.svn
 rm -rf ${BUILDDIR}${BLFS_ROOT}/menu/.svn
 rm -rf ${BUILDDIR}${BLFS_ROOT}/menu/lxdialog/.svn
+# We do not want to keep an old version of the book:
+rm -rf ${BUILDDIR}${BLFS_ROOT}/blfs-xml
 
 # Set some harcoded envars to their proper values
 sed -i s at tracking-dir@$TRACKING_DIR@ \
@@ -110,7 +112,9 @@
 [[ $VERBOSITY > 0 ]] && echo "... OK"
 
 [[ $VERBOSITY > 0 ]] && echo -n "Downloading and validating the book (may take some time)"
-make -j1 -C $BUILDDIR$BLFS_ROOT TRACKING_DIR=$TRACKING_DIR \
-    $BUILDDIR$BLFS_ROOT/packages.xml
+make -j1 -C $BUILDDIR$BLFS_ROOT \
+     TRACKING_DIR=$TRACKING_DIR \
+     SVN=svn://svn.linuxfromscratch.org/BLFS/$BLFS_TREE \
+     $BUILDDIR$BLFS_ROOT/packages.xml
 [[ $VERBOSITY > 0 ]] && echo "... OK"
 


More information about the alfs-log mailing list